Once again the BDI (Baltic Dry Index) is running out steam and at best might create further shocks; Geopolitics still getting worse. John Faraclas’ daily and weekly recap:

The BDI ended the day at 1,219 points – just two higher since yesterday and 94 since last Friday the 19 of January. (from 1,125)

Still the BDI is over 1,000 points – to be more precise, it is 1,028 points below the end of December 2013 when it stood at 2,247, just over four years in which we even witnessed the BDI down to 290 points on the 10th of February 2016!!!

The Capers were up 20 points since yesterday and the BCI now stands at 1,772, which is also 279 points higher from last week’s closing (1,493)… A very volatile index and it remains to be seen what’s next. We believe after one or two months we can ascertain the situation better…

The Panamaxes were up 11 points with BPI now reads 1,492 points; on a weekly basis the BPI gained 159 points  (from 1,333).

On the antipode the Supras and the Handies were both down four points with the BSI and BHSI standing at 900 and 577 respectively. On a weekly basis the Supras lost 11 points – from 911, and seven from 584 respectively…

The Wets with mixed feelings on the daily trading; the last published BDTI (Dirties) and BCTI (Cleans) stood at 683 – minus eight and 589 – plus 18 respectively. On a weekly basis both Wet indices were down; the Dirties 24 – from 707 and the Cleans 20 – from 609…
